Heather Barnes graduated from the University of Nebraska - Lincoln with majors in English and Film Studies. She is a writer, poet, and lover of slam poetry. She lives in Lincoln, NE, and is excited to be the slam master for the SO WHAT SLAM in addition to writing and her other creative endeavors.
